1. Understanding T3 and Its Function

T3 is one of the two primary thyroid hormones, the other being T4 (thyroxine). While T4 is converted into T3 in various tissues throughout the body, T3 is the more active form. It directly influences the metabolic rate and is vital for growth, development, and metabolism, particularly in how our bodies utilize fats as an energy source.

2. Mechanisms Through Which T3 Enhances Fat Metabolism

There are several ways T3 contributes to increased fat metabolism:

  1. Increased Basal Metabolic Rate (BMR): T3 elevates the BMR, meaning the body expends more calories at rest. This increased energy expenditure encourages fat utilization.
  2. Enhanced Lipolysis: T3 promotes the breakdown of fat stores into free fatty acids, a process known as lipolysis. By enhancing this process, T3 helps the body tap into its fat reserves more efficiently.
  3. Improved Mitochondrial Function: T3 stimulates mitochondrial activity, increasing ATP production. This uptick in energy production allows the body to use more fat for fuel.
  4. Regulation of Key Enzymes: T3 influences the expression of enzymes involved in lipid metabolism, such as hormone-sensitive lipase (HSL), aiding fat breakdown during energy demands.
